Rosemary (Rosmarinus officinalis) is a fragrant evergreen herb native to the Mediterranean region. Used for centuries in traditional medicine and cooking, rosemary is known for its rich aroma and powerful health benefits. Packed with antioxidants, vitamins, and essential oils, rosemary is a natural remedy for various ailments. Rosemary seems to increase blood circulation when applied to the scalp, which might help hair follicles grow. Rosemary extract might also help protect the skin from sun damage.
People commonly use rosemary for memory, indigestion, fatigue, hair loss, and many other purposes, but there is no good scientific evidence to support most of these uses.

Special Precautions and Warnings
When taken by mouth: Rosemary is commonly consumed in foods. Rosemary leaf is possibly safe for most people when taken as a medicine for up to 8 weeks. But taking undiluted rosemary oil or very large amounts of rosemary leaf is likely unsafe. Taking large amounts of rosemary can cause vomiting, sun sensitivity, and skin redness.
When applied to the skin: Rosemary oil is possibly safe for most people. It might cause allergic reactions in some people.
When inhaled: Rosemary is possibly safe for most people when used as aromatherapy.
Pregnancy: Rosemary is commonly consumed in foods. Rosemary is possibly unsafe when taken by mouth in medicinal amounts during pregnancy. It might cause a miscarriage. There isn't enough reliable information to know if rosemary is safe when applied to the skin when pregnant. Stay on the safe side and avoid use.
Breast-feeding: There isn't enough reliable information to know if rosemary is safe to use as medicine when breast-feeding. Stay on the safe side and stick to food amounts.
Bleeding disorders: Rosemary might increase the risk of bleeding and bruising in people with bleeding disorders. Use cautiously.
Seizure disorders: Rosemary might make seizure disorders worse. Don't use more than amounts found in foods.
Dosing
Sri herbal Rosemary is commonly consumed as a spice and flavoring in foods.
Rosemary oil, powder, and extract have also been used by adults as medicine. There isn't enough reliable information to know what an appropriate dose of rosemary might be. Keep in mind that natural products are not always necessarily safe and dosages can be important. Be sure to follow relevant directions on product labels and consult a healthcare professional before using.
